Watercolor Polka Dots Tumbler Sublimation Illustrations: A Brand Designer’s Review

First Impressions: Soft, Playful, and Versatile Visual Energy

As a brand designer who’s worked with dozens of small businesses and content creators, the first thing I noticed about Watercolor Polka Dots Tumbler Sublimation Illustrations was the soft, organic texture. The watercolor effect gives it a handcrafted, approachable feel, while the polka dots add a touch of rhythm and visual interest. It’s a design asset that immediately reads as friendly, creative, and slightly whimsical—perfect for brands that want to feel accessible without losing visual polish.

Mood & Emotional Tone: Casual Elegance for Lifestyle and Creative Brands

This design leans toward a casual yet elegant aesthetic. It’s not overly formal, which makes it ideal for lifestyle brands, wellness coaches, creative entrepreneurs, and product creators selling handmade or artisanal goods. The watercolor texture evokes a sense of authenticity and warmth, while the repeating polka dot pattern adds a structured playfulness that can elevate visual content without overwhelming the message.

Real-World Use Case: Launching a Seasonal Product with Cohesive Branding

Let’s say you’re a small business launching a summer-themed tumbler line. You need consistent visuals across your Instagram posts, Pinterest pins, packaging inserts, and email banners. Watercolor Polka Dots Tumbler Sublimation Illustrations can act as a unifying visual thread—used subtly in headers, as a background texture in Canva templates, or as a decorative accent on product mockups. It helps maintain a cohesive brand identity while adding a touch of artistic flair.

Supporting Marketing Goals with Visual Strategy

This design asset supports key marketing objectives by:

  1. Creating a stronger first impression through its soft yet vibrant aesthetic.
  2. Establishing visual hierarchy when used as a background element behind bold text or icons.
  3. Improving audience trust by offering a consistent, professional look across content formats.
  4. Strengthening brand recognition through repeatable patterns and textures that become part of your visual language.
  5. Enhancing emotional connection with its warm, human feel—ideal for brands focused on authenticity and creativity.
